Exit Window Installation Price Range in Clearwater, FL
Typical costs for exit window installation in Clearwater, FL, generally fall within a certain range depending on the project specifics. The following provides an overview of expected price ranges and common project types.
$1,200 - $2,500 for standard residential exit window installations
$2,500 - $4,500 for larger or custom exit window projects
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ic basement exit window | $1,200 - $1,800 |
| Standard egress window replacement | $1,500 - $2,500 |
| Custom-sized exit window |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Fire escape window installation | $2,200 - $4,500 |
| Additional framing or structural work |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Finish work and trim | $500 - $1,200 |
What affects the cost of Exit Window Installation
Several factors can influence the overall expense of installing exit windows in Clearwater, FL. Understanding these elements can help in comparing options and estimating project costs accurately.
- Materials: The type of window and framing materials selected can impact costs, with options like aluminum, vinyl, or wood affecting the price range.
- Size and Scope: Larger or multiple exit windows require more materials and labor, influencing the overall project cost.
- Labor Complexity: Installation difficulty may vary depending on existing structures, wall types, and accessibility, affecting labor time and costs.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Clearwater may require permits, which can include fees and inspection costs.
- Additional Features or Extras: Items such as security bars, egress hardware, or specialized glass can add to the total expense.
